Why last minute offers are so advantageous

A holiday in Egypt from Bucharest – especially tours to Egypt – is a win–win opportunity both for tour operators and their clients. When travel companies sell packages with discounts of 30–50% a few days before departure, they fill up charter flights, minimise losses from unsold packages and increase overall profit. Travellers who are ready to react quickly to such offers get several clear advantages:

They save on accommodation, often staying in a prestigious hotel at the price of a budget one;

The price already includes flight and transfer to and from the hotel;

Extra bonuses: quite often the package includes excursions, free accommodation for children and other pleasant surprises.

Seasonality in Egypt: the best time to travel

A very common question: in which month is it best to spend your holiday in Egypt, and when are the packages cheapest? Beaches in Egypt welcome tourists almost all year round, so hunting for a good value Egypt tour is not limited to the summer months.

Winter months

Tours to Egypt in December and January, as well as packages for February, are quite popular because daytime air temperatures are around +22 to +25°C and water temperature about +22°C – comfortable for swimming. However, in winter it is often windy, so December marks the start of lower prices and special offers on last minute holidays. If you choose a sheltered bay with little wind, the comfort level will be high thanks to the mild temperatures and the absence of very strong sun – ideal for a calm beach holiday and sightseeing. Winter holidays in Egypt with children are best spent in hotels with heated pools and kids’ clubs. Evenings can be chilly, so warm clothes are needed.

Spring months

A spring holiday in Egypt is the perfect combination of warm weather and a relatively small number of tourists. The climate becomes as pleasant as possible for the beach: average air temperature is around +25 to +30°C, and water is warmer than at the start of the year (about +23 to +26°C). If you book offers to Egypt for March, choose hotels with good entertainment infrastructure and plan to visit the main sights, as the weather is a bit cooler than in late spring. In April and May, beach conditions become almost ideal and children’s animation programmes begin to run at full speed.

Summer months

Summer in Egypt (June–August) is a period of high temperatures: air between +30 and +45°C, water around +28 to +30°C. That’s why seasonal discounts and special offers from tour operators often appear, especially if your decision to travel is truly last minute.

Last minute offers to Egypt in June are cheap packages suitable for a classic summer beach holiday: air temperature +30 to +38°C, water +28 to +30°C. This month marks the start of the season with clear skies and minimal rainfall.

If you manage to buy a cheap tour to Egypt in July, you can expect quite high daytime temperatures (up to +40°C) and very warm water around +30°C, which creates great conditions for beach time, especially on the western coast. This is the ideal period for young travellers (swimming in the morning and evening, then nightlife), but it is not recommended for small children or elderly people because of the intense heat.

August is the hottest month in Egypt, with air temperatures up to +45°C and the Red Sea warming to about +32°C. It is perfect for active beach holidays and water entertainment such as diving or parasailing. Clear skies and warm sea create excellent conditions for young people who want to enjoy nightlife and beach parties. However, the heat can be exhausting for excursions and is not recommended for toddlers or elderly travellers.

Autumn months

Autumn tours to Egypt from Bucharest are a wonderful option when scorching summer days are replaced by milder weather and excursions become more comfortable and safe.

Cheap offers from Romania to Egypt in September mean good weather for swimming without extreme heat: air temperature +30 to +35°C and the Red Sea around +28°C.

October: average air temperature is +25 to +30°C, water about +26°C. It is one of the best months to visit Egypt, suitable both for beach holidays and excursions.

November: air temperature +20 to +25°C, water around +24°C. Perfect for people who prefer a cooler climate. Beaches are not crowded and package prices are more affordable.

Prices for all inclusive packages in Egypt depend heavily on the season: in summer there are often last minute offers and discounts in the hottest period (July/August), but the very cheapest deals can usually be found in winter (with the exception of New Year and Christmas holidays).

Top 5 popular beaches in Egypt

1. Naama Bay (Sharm El Sheikh)

The most popular beach in Sharm El Sheikh. Naama Bay attracts tourists with its sandy shoreline, clear water and well–developed infrastructure. You can enjoy snorkelling, diving and various water sports. The promenade is full of restaurants, bars and shops – a lively place both during the day and at night.

2. Sahl Hasheesh Beach (Hurghada)

Considered one of the most elite and beautiful beaches in Hurghada. Wide sandy shores and crystal–clear water make it an ideal spot for families, swimming and pure relaxation.

3. Abu Dabbab (Marsa Alam)

Famous for untouched coral reefs and rich marine life. Here you can see sea turtles and dugongs, which makes this bay especially popular with diving and snorkelling enthusiasts.

4. Hadaba (Sharm El Sheikh)

Offers a wide sandy beach with comfortable entry into the sea and is popular among families with children. The beach is equipped with sunbeds and umbrellas, and there are many cafés and restaurants nearby. You can relax here and admire beautiful views of the Red Sea.

5. Nabq Bay (Sharm El Sheikh)

Nabq Bay is known for its excellent sandy beaches and is perfect for kitesurfing and windsurfing thanks to steady winds. The area offers a variety of luxury hotels and quiet areas for relaxation, making it a great choice for romantic or family trips.

Best resorts in Egypt for a perfect holiday

Here are the top 5 most popular resorts in Egypt:

1. Sharm El Sheikh

A famous resort in the south of the Sinai Peninsula, Sharm El Sheikh attracts tourists with its amazing beaches, coral reefs and rich infrastructure. It offers many activities, including diving, snorkelling, camel rides and desert safaris. For nightlife lovers there are plenty of bars, restaurants and clubs.

2. Hurghada

One of the oldest and best–known resorts on the Red Sea coast, offering a wide range of entertainment and generally affordable prices. The resort is divided into three main areas: the old town (El Dahar), the new town (Sakkala) and the modern tourist strip. Hurghada is famous for its sandy beaches, water sports and variety of excursions.

3. Marsa Alam

A resort on the southern Red Sea coast, known for its pristine coral reefs and unique marine life, including dolphins and sea turtles. Marsa Alam is ideal for divers, snorkellers and travellers seeking peace and seclusion away from busy tourist centres.

4. El Quseir

Situated between Hurghada and Marsa Alam, El Quseir is known for its historical sites, old fortress and coral reefs. It is a quiet resort ideal for those who want to combine beach relaxation with exploring Egypt’s history. Conditions for diving and snorkelling are excellent here.

5. El Gouna

A resort town on the Red Sea coast famous for its artificial lagoons and sandy beaches. El Gouna offers a range of activities: water sports, golf and yacht trips. The beaches are perfect both for family holidays and romantic escapes.

Frequently asked questions about last minute holidays to Egypt from Bucharest

What exactly is a last minute tour to Egypt from Bucharest?

A last minute tour is a heavily discounted package, often with 30–50% off, sold just a few days or hours before departure when the tour operator still has unsold seats on the plane and rooms in the hotel.

Is it safe to travel with children on a last minute deal?

Yes, as long as you choose family–friendly hotels with suitable infrastructure, such as heated pools in winter, kids’ clubs, waterparks and gentle sandy entry into the sea, and avoid the most extreme heat with very young children.

How long is the direct flight from Bucharest to Egypt?

The direct flight to Hurghada or Sharm El Sheikh takes approximately 3 hours and 20 minutes.

How often do last minute deals to Egypt appear?

They appear most often in off–peak periods or when there are unsold seats on flights – for example in winter outside the holiday season, at the beginning of summer or right after peak dates.

What is usually included in an all inclusive package in Egypt?

Usually accommodation, three main buffet meals, snacks, local drinks, use of pools and beach, hotel animation and sometimes access to a waterpark or sports activities.

In which months are Egypt holidays the cheapest?

Prices tend to be lowest in winter (except over Christmas and New Year) and during the hottest summer months, July and August, when more last minute deals appear.

Which resort is best for a first holiday in Egypt?

For a first trip, many travellers choose Sharm El Sheikh or Hurghada thanks to their comfortable beaches, developed infrastructure, large choice of all inclusive hotels and many excursion options.

Can I choose a specific hotel if the tour is last minute?

Often the hotel is already specified in the last minute package. Sometimes there are 'blind' offers where only region, star rating and board type are fixed, but the price is lower precisely for that reason.

Which beaches in Egypt are best for children?

Beaches with gentle sandy entry into the sea are most suitable – for example certain areas in Hurghada, Sahl Hasheesh and the lagoons of El Gouna, where swimming is more comfortable for kids and beginners.

Where is all inclusive better value: Egypt or Turkey?

In many cases Egypt offers a similar level of service and infrastructure to Turkey, but at more affordable prices, especially if you use last minute offers and seasonal discounts.

What is the water temperature in the Red Sea throughout the year?

In winter the water is around +22°C, in spring it warms to about +23 to +26°C, and in summer it reaches +28 to +30°C, sometimes up to roughly +32°C in August.
